digital_ocean_certificate_facts – Gather facts about DigitalOcean certificates
New in version 2.6.
Synopsis
- This module can be used to gather facts about DigitalOcean provided certificates.
 
Requirements
The below requirements are needed on the host that executes this module.
- python >= 2.6
 
Parameters
| Parameter | Choices/Defaults | Comments | 
|---|---|---|
|  certificate_id   -    |    Certificate ID that can be used to identify and reference a certificate.   |  |
|  oauth_token   string    |    DigitalOcean OAuth token.  There are several other environment variables which can be used to provide this value.  i.e., - 'DO_API_TOKEN', 'DO_API_KEY', 'DO_OAUTH_TOKEN' and 'OAUTH_TOKEN'  aliases: api_token  |  |
|  timeout   integer    |   Default: 30   |    The timeout in seconds used for polling DigitalOcean's API.   |  
|  validate_certs   boolean    |   
  |    If set to   no, the SSL certificates will not be validated.This should only set to   no used on personally controlled sites using self-signed certificates. |  
Examples
- name: Gather facts about all certificates
  digital_ocean_certificate_facts:
    oauth_token: "{{ oauth_token }}"
- name: Gather facts about certificate with given id
  digital_ocean_certificate_facts:
    oauth_token: "{{ oauth_token }}"
    certificate_id: "892071a0-bb95-49bc-8021-3afd67a210bf"
- name: Get not after facts about certificate
  digital_ocean_certificate_facts:
  register: resp_out
- set_fact:
    not_after_date: "{{ item.not_after }}"
  loop: "{{ resp_out.data|json_query(name) }}"
  vars:
    name: "[?name=='web-cert-01']"
- debug: var=not_after_date
   Return Values
Common return values are documented here, the following are the fields unique to this module:
| Key | Returned | Description | 
|---|---|---|
|  data  list   |  success |   DigitalOcean certificate facts  Sample:  [{'id': '892071a0-bb95-49bc-8021-3afd67a210bf', 'name': 'web-cert-01', 'not_after': '2017-02-22T00:23:00Z', 'sha1_fingerprint': 'dfcc9f57d86bf58e321c2c6c31c7a971be244ac7', 'created_at': '2017-02-08T16:02:37Z'}]   |
